Heidi Klum celebrated the 10th anniversary of “Project Runway” at NYC’s Highline Tuesday evening, looking elegant in a black dress and gold with white eye makeup that looked stunning contrasting her dark ensemble.
The 39-year-old model/businesswoman wore a little black Francesco Scognamiglio dress that featured a loose chiffon top, a plunging neckline and padded shoulders. She then paired the knee-length dress with nude Valentino peep-toe pumps, three sparkly Lorraine Schwartz bangles, a shimmering ring, and a diamond pendant necklace.
Although we’re missing color on Heidi Klum’s outfit, we think her makeup for the event looked stunning. For a fresh-looking face, Heidi made her eyes pop with gold eyeshadow with white eyeliner (either a soft cream eyeshadow or a sharpened eye pencil) lining her lower lash line. InStyle notes that this trick can make small eyes appear larger, soften smokey eye makeup and create a fresher or ‘awake’ appearance. Add brown shadow to soften the look. Champagne, nude and flesh-colored eyeliners work the same way as white ones.
